Gone are the days when you could glance at the league table, see a strong team facing a weaker one, and confidently place your bet. Football’s more unpredictable now. Data analytics, player tracking technologies, and even AI algorithms influence how odds are set. This means relying on gut feelings or old-school logic isn’t enough.

A team might be unbeaten in their last five matches, but if their xG (expected goals) is lower than their actual goals scored, they might be overperforming. That’s a red flag for savvy bettors. In 2025, data-driven insights are your best friend.

Embrace Data Analysis

Numbers don’t lie. Stats like xG, possession percentages, shot accuracy, and player heat maps reveal a lot more than traditional match reports. Websites like WhoScored and Understat offer details to help you spot trends and make informed decisions.

Focus on Value, Not Just Wins

Chasing favorites might feel safe, but it’s not always profitable. The trick is to find value bets – those where the odds underestimate a team’s real chances. For example, if Everton’s form has been shaky, but key players are back from injury, their odds might not reflect that boost. That’s where you find value.

Diversify Your Markets

Betting isn’t just about predicting winners. Explore other markets like:

  • Over/Under Goals: Great when you expect a high-scoring or tight match.
  • Asian Handicaps: Reduces the risk in uneven fixtures.
  • Player Props: Betting on individual performances (goals, assists, cards) can offer great odds, especially with in-form players.

Stay Updated with Team News

A last-minute injury or tactical shift can flip a game’s outcome. Follow reliable sources, check pre-match press conferences, and keep an eye on team sheets. Apps like SofaScore provide real-time updates.

Mastering Bankroll Management

No matter how sharp your strategies are, poor bankroll management can sink you. Here’s how to keep things in check:

  • Set a Budget: Decide how much you can afford to lose without it affecting your life. This is your bankroll.
  • Bet with Units: Instead of random amounts, use units (e.g., 1 unit = 1% of your bankroll). This keeps your betting consistent and controlled.
  • Avoid Chasing Losses: Losing streaks happen. Doubling down to recover losses usually leads to even bigger ones. Stay disciplined.
  • Track Your Bets: Keep a record of wins, losses, and bet types. This helps identify what’s working and what’s not.

Spotting Betting Traps and Common Biases

Even the smartest bettors fall into traps. Here are some to watch out for:

  • The Gambler’s Fallacy: Believing a team is “due” for a win after a losing streak. Football doesn’t owe anyone results.
  • Recency Bias: Overvaluing recent performances while ignoring long-term trends.
  • Overconfidence in Favorites: Bookies love bettors who blindly back big-name clubs. Upsets happen more often than you think.
